Mother and Child Statue "Under Fire of War"

March 10, 1945, at the end of the Asia Pacific War, there was an indiscriminate bombing raid called Great Tokyo Air Raid,by the U.S. military. It lasted for over two hours and destroyed an area of downtown Tokyo, killing about 100,000 people. On the other hand, Japan also bombed China and other countries after the Manchurian Incident. Many people were burned, damaged, and lost their lives in air raids. Most of them were civilians, including women, children and the elderly. Madonna and Child in stone

Material: Stone. Accession no: HCM 031. Current location: [The Hunt Museum](https://www.huntmuseum.com/), [Limerick](https://www.geonames.org/7778675/limerick-city.html). A [polychrome](http://vocab.getty.edu/page/aat/300252261) [figure sculpture](http://vocab.getty.edu/page/aat/300047600 ) of the Madonna and Child in limestone. The Virgin is crowned, with a pendant veil and wearing a long draped gown. Mary carries the Infant Jesus on her hip and is gently holding his foot. The top half of the child is missing. There are traces of original paint on the statue. [14th or 15th century AD](http://n2t.net/ark:/99152/p08m57h8zmq), [Burgundy](http://www.geonames.org/3030967/bourgogne.html).
